[QUOTE="ghce, post: 236279, member: 38725"] 200 mg weekly is really too high a dose to start. These sort of dosage were prescribed years ago and are the result of bad and lack of information that most doctors even today are not aware of. Research on forums like this will soon point you in the right direction or alternatively find a reputable Hormone therapy centre such as the site sponsor here for modern protocols. Always remember it's your health we are talking about not your Doctors and you need know by doing due diligence what's best and safest for you, there really is a lot of bad protocols dispensed by GP's who don't know any better.
